I wanted to review it because there weren't many reviews when I bought it. They are much nicer than I expected. I needed them quickly to get the job done and decided to buy better ones later. I've used them on brass, carbon steel, leather and various copper/silver alloys with no problem. They cut cleanly, the burrs themselves are well cut. I had no problems with chipping. I ran them at 15,000 RPM because that's the highest speed my flexshaft runs at, but I wish I had something closer to 30,000-50,000 RPM. Small burrs, especially carbide burrs, like to work really fast . If you're having problems, you're probably running them too slowly. If you want to see my work check out Kevin Klein Blades.
